[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]“Hi there; I have been thinking of you all so much. How are you?[/quote] PP who lost a child. "How are you?" is a minefield. How do you think I am? How can I possibly answer that question? I'm shattered, but I am not going to say that. So, I stand there and fight tears while I desperately try and figure out a polite answer. If you're going to make me cry in the grocery store, do it by saying his name. Or stop after "I've been thinking about you." if you have a relationship. Or "Hello" if you don't.
